[CC說]用黃金圈思維來思考測試

黃金圈.jpg

黃金圈思維是什么?

學(xué)習(xí)了黃金圈思維就可以獲取到黃金么?

maybe,還真可以。

黃金圈法則源于 Simon Sinek 的理論。

Simon Sinek 發(fā)現(xiàn)人們向別人表達或者激勵一般是從 現(xiàn)象 - 措施 -結(jié)果

而真正有用和打動人心的應(yīng)該是 理念 -措施- 現(xiàn)象 - 結(jié)果

在每日的工作或者生活中,大多數(shù)的人知道自己在做的是什么。比方說上級給我們交代的具體任務(wù),或者父母交待的某項事情等等。僅僅有少部分人知道為什么要這樣做(why),這個差別可以稱之為差異價值,也就是通常說的“Think Different”。

黃金圈思維法則.jpg

黃金圈思維法則是一種由內(nèi)而外的思考方式,分三層

  • Why:思考為什么要這么做、我們的目標、理念;
  • How:采用什么方法、措施;
  • What:我們的產(chǎn)品表現(xiàn)形式。

比如我們來思考一下 測試設(shè)計這個活動:

  • Why(為什么要做測試設(shè)計) :
    實際的項目執(zhí)行中,有時候測試人員也會直接拿著需求開始測試執(zhí)行,那 測試設(shè)計 這個階段是必須的么?

CC先生能考慮到的原因有以下幾個,歡迎大家討論或者補充:

  1. 組織需要知識經(jīng)驗的積累。
    雖然敏捷開發(fā)大行其道,但是也不得不承認,如果需要一個團隊長期的穩(wěn)定的產(chǎn)出成果,且能不斷改進的同時,Knowledge Base庫就是必不可少的。也就是,組織需要采取各種方式將之前的經(jīng)驗值進行沉淀,英雄可以有,但不常有。

  2. 測試外包的場景下,測試質(zhì)量更能把控。

  3. 測試過程需要接受審計,比如CMMI的評級等過程。

  4. 組織中不同業(yè)務(wù)成熟度的測試人員一個互相學(xué)習(xí)的過程和良好手段。

  • How(怎么做測試設(shè)計)

此處應(yīng)該引入測試設(shè)計的各種方法,等價類邊界值,場景法,狀態(tài)遷移法等等,這里就不一一而論了。

  • What (什么是測試設(shè)計)

如果說測試分析是明確測試目標的過程,測試設(shè)計就是得出具體測試實例(或者測試用例)以達到測試目標的過程。

展現(xiàn)出來的形式也就是我們經(jīng)??吹降臏y試實例表(或者測試用例表)

以上是對具體的一個測試活動的黃金圈思維的思考。大家可以推而廣之。

做測試通常也是先從需求的角度也就是Why的層面考慮,挖掘用戶本質(zhì)的需求,然后從How的層面考慮是用一個手工測試方案還是一個自動化測試方案去測試這個需求,最后再從what層面去考究采用什么自動化工具、測試用例展現(xiàn)方式,bug管理流程等等。

比如說之前參加過一次ThoughWorks的活動,里面就有一個需求是 一個飛機的訂票系統(tǒng)里面需要加一個“改簽” 的按鈕。

當場就讓大家進行測試設(shè)計。

那第一個問題就是,為什么我們需要一個“改簽”按鈕呢?

是因為客戶時間來不及還是航班號填錯了還是其它原因?

更主要的是,客戶除了改簽還有沒有其它的需求呢?加這個按鈕我們是為了實現(xiàn)更多的客戶價值還是為了增長更多的客戶?

所以,學(xué)會黃金圈的思維方式,你已經(jīng)掌握了理念 -措施- 現(xiàn)象 - 結(jié)果的基本原理。

試著,用這個來思考一下你最近的測試活動吧,歡迎留言討論哦~~~

最后編輯于
?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請聯(lián)系作者
【社區(qū)內(nèi)容提示】社區(qū)部分內(nèi)容疑似由AI輔助生成,瀏覽時請結(jié)合常識與多方信息審慎甄別。
平臺聲明:文章內(nèi)容(如有圖片或視頻亦包括在內(nèi))由作者上傳并發(fā)布,文章內(nèi)容僅代表作者本人觀點,簡書系信息發(fā)布平臺,僅提供信息存儲服務(wù)。

相關(guān)閱讀更多精彩內(nèi)容

友情鏈接更多精彩內(nèi)容